2011-12 Penticton Vees to be inducted into BC Sports Hall of Fame

Earlier this week, the BC Sports Hall of Fame announced their upcoming induction class and the 2011-12 Penticton Vees are set to be enshrined in the team category.

That year, the Vees finished the BC Hockey League regular season with a 54-4-0-2 record and set a Canadian Junior A record for most consecutive regular-season wins with 42 straight victories. They went on to win the Fred Page Cup, Doyle Cup and a National Championship.

“It’s another proud moment for a team that was outstanding in so many ways,” said Vees head coach, general manager and president Fred Harbinson. “Our captain said it best, that this was a team that was late to take credit and early to take blae. It’s not easy to find that commitment with that level of talent.”

The 2011-12 team is just the second junior team and 12th hockey team to be inducted into the BC Sports Hall of Fame. They were inducted into the BC Hockey Hall of Fame in July.

The 2023 BC Sports Hall of Fame induction ceremony is scheduled for June, 2023.
